Nvidia to Invest Up to $100 Billion in OpenAI to Build 10-Gigawatt AI Data Centers

The staged deal ties funding to installed capacity, reinforcing Nvidia’s push to anchor OpenAI’s next wave of data centers.

Overview

  • The partnership targets at least 10 gigawatts of new AI infrastructure, with about 1 gigawatt expected online in the second half of 2026.
  • Nvidia is expected to begin supplying OpenAI with Vera Rubin–generation processors from late 2026, according to multiple reports.
  • Funding is structured in tranches reportedly around $10 billion per installed gigawatt, with an initial payment tied to a finalized contract.
  • Media reports say Nvidia would receive non‑voting shares while OpenAI uses the invested funds to purchase Nvidia GPUs.
  • Nvidia shares rose roughly 4–4.5% to a record high after the announcement, while the companies said OpenAI’s partnership with Microsoft remains unchanged and final deal terms will be settled in the coming weeks.
